| CPC G06T 17/20 (2013.01) [A63F 13/52 (2014.09)] | 20 Claims |

|
1. A non-transitory computer-readable medium comprising instructions, the instructions, when executed by a computing system, causing the computing system to perform operations including:
identifying, using activity data corresponding to a user of a client device, a virtual rendered object;
determining an area of the virtual rendered object, the virtual rendered object configured to have a pattern;
generating an aperiodic tiling of an irregular polygon using a machine learning model, wherein the machine learning model is configured to apply convolutional padding to determine pixel values at a seam between a pair of interlocked irregular polygons; and
presenting for display at the client device the aperiodic tiling of the irregular polygon in the area of the virtual rendered object, the aperiodic tiling representative of the pattern.
|